Vancouver, BC, Canada: Raincoast Book Distribution, 2004. Book. Very Good+. Hardcover. Signed by Author(s). Canadian First. First edition, first printing as evidenced by a complete number line from 1 to 10; signed by Anosh Irani in his characteristic way on the title page with no inscription; minor edge wear; otherwise a solid, clean copy with no marking or underlining; cigar band around back cover is in very good condition; collectable condition overall.
Synopsis
ANOSH IRANI is the author of the acclaimed novels The Song of Kahunsha , a finalist for Canada Reads and the Ethel Wilson Fiction Prize in 2007, and his recently published novel, Dahanu Road . His play Bombay Black won four Dora Mavor Moore Awards in 2006 including for Outstanding New Play, and he was nominated for the 2007 Governor General's Award for The Bombay Plays: The Matka King and Bombay Black .
